About

Vikas Verma is a scholar working on Renewable Energy, Sustainability and the Environment, Mechanical Engineering and Building and Construction. According to data from OpenAlex, Vikas Verma has authored 22 papers receiving a total of 276 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Renewable Energy, Sustainability and the Environment, 13 papers in Mechanical Engineering and 6 papers in Building and Construction. Recurrent topics in Vikas Verma's work include Geothermal Energy Systems and Applications (10 papers), Building Energy and Comfort Optimization (6 papers) and Solar Energy Systems and Technologies (6 papers). Vikas Verma is often cited by papers focused on Geothermal Energy Systems and Applications (10 papers), Building Energy and Comfort Optimization (6 papers) and Solar Energy Systems and Technologies (6 papers). Vikas Verma collaborates with scholars based in India, Israel and Oman. Vikas Verma's co-authors include K. Murugesan, Rahul Tarodiya, T. Sivasakthivel, M. Philippe, Pingfang Hu, Ashwani Kumar, Tushar Choudhary, Gaurav Dwivedi, Chandan Swaroop Meena and Biraj Kumar Kakati and has published in prestigious journals such as Renewable Energy, Energy and Buildings and Sustainable Energy Technologies and Assessments.
